Elon Musk Threatens Delaware

Elon Musk and his complaints with the state of Delaware: The Associated Press

Delaware’s Business Allure: Unraveling the Mystery Behind Corporate Registration Trends

 

In the competitive landscape of American business, one peculiar trend has stood the test of time – the overwhelming choice of Delaware as the preferred state for company registration. A staggering 75% of American companies find their legal home in the small but influential state, sparking curiosity among business enthusiasts and analysts alike.

The Delaware Advantage:

Delaware’s appeal lies in its business-friendly environment, offering a unique set of advantages that prompt companies to choose it over other states. The state’s well-established and predictable corporate laws provide a level of consistency and stability that businesses find attractive. Delaware’s Court of Chancery, a specialized court for business disputes, is renowned for its expertise, swift resolution, and precedents that offer clarity to corporate legal matters.

Flexible Corporate Laws:

Delaware has a reputation for having one of the most flexible and accommodating sets of corporate laws in the United States. The state’s General Corporation Law allows companies significant freedom in structuring their internal affairs, providing a framework that facilitates efficient corporate governance and operations. This flexibility allows businesses to tailor their structures to specific needs, promoting innovation and adaptability.

Privacy and Confidentiality:

Delaware offers a degree of privacy and confidentiality to businesses that choose to register within its borders. The state doesn’t require companies to disclose the names of their shareholders or directors in their formation documents. This level of anonymity can be attractive to businesses seeking to protect sensitive information or maintain a low profile.

Taxation Considerations:

While not a zero-tax state, Delaware’s tax structure is favorable for many businesses. The absence of a sales tax, coupled with no taxes on intangible assets like patents and trademarks, provides a financial incentive for companies to choose Delaware. Additionally, the state doesn’t impose corporate income tax on companies that operate outside of Delaware.

National Consistency:

Another factor contributing to Delaware’s popularity is its uniformity in corporate laws, which creates a consistent legal framework across all registered entities. This ensures that businesses can operate seamlessly across state lines without navigating disparate legal systems. For companies with a national or international footprint, Delaware’s streamlined legal environment simplifies compliance and reduces regulatory complexity.

In conclusion, the dominance of Delaware as the state of choice for company registration in the United States is a result of a combination of factors. From flexible corporate laws to a business-friendly environment, Delaware has created a compelling package that appeals to a wide range of enterprises. As the business landscape continues to evolve, Delaware’s enduring allure is likely to remain a key aspect of the corporate world.

Caesar Rodney, Business Journalist, Parrot Advertising Group

 

Leave a Comment

Your email address will not be published. Required fields are marked *

Accessibility
Scroll to Top